Как ускорить загрузку сайта
Три секунды. Столько в среднем готов ждать посетитель, прежде чем закроет вкладку и уйдёт к конкуренту. А поисковик это запомнит. Скорость влияет и на позиции, и на продажи — медленный сайт теряет и то, и другое одновременно. Хорошая новость: чаще всего тормозит он по двум-трём простым причинам, и их реально устранить самому.
Сначала измерьте
Не чините вслепую. Сперва замерьте, сколько сайт грузится сейчас и что именно его держит. Иначе можно неделю оптимизировать скрипты, когда всё дело в одной фотографии на 5 мегабайт.
Сожмите картинки — это №1
В девяти случаях из десяти главный тормоз — изображения. Фотографию с телефона весом в 4 МБ браузер тащит дольше, чем весь остальной сайт. Что делать? Уменьшайте размер до реального (не нужна картинка 4000 пикселей в блоке шириной 600), сжимайте через TinyPNG или Squoosh, переводите в современный формат WebP. Одно это часто ускоряет страницу вдвое.
Уберите лишние скрипты
Каждый сторонний виджет — чат, счётчик, карта, кнопки соцсетей — это дополнительный запрос и задержка. Посчитайте, сколько их у вас. Половину обычно можно убрать без потерь, а оставшиеся — подгружать асинхронно, чтобы они не блокировали отрисовку страницы.
Включите кэш и сжатие
Кэширование заставляет браузер сохранять файлы у себя, чтобы при повторном визите не качать их заново. Сжатие gzip уменьшает вес страниц в несколько раз ещё на сервере. Оба включаются парой строк в настройках сервера — а эффект заметный. Если не хотите лезть в конфиги руками, нужные правила соберёт генератор.
Проверьте хостинг
Иногда дело не в сайте, а в сервере. Дешёвый перегруженный хостинг отвечает по полсекунды ещё до того, как начнёт грузиться хоть одна картинка. Замерьте время ответа сервера: если оно стабильно выше 0,5 секунды, задумайтесь о переезде на хостинг получше.
С чего начать — узнайте за минуту
Замерьте скорость сайта и увидите, что именно его тормозит.
Проверить скорость →Подведём по-простому: сожмите картинки, выкиньте лишние скрипты, включите кэш и сжатие, проверьте хостинг. Эти четыре шага закрывают почти все проблемы со скоростью. Начните с замера — и вы сразу увидите, за что хвататься. А как скорость встроена в общую оптимизацию, читайте в статье про технический аудит сайта и в гайде как раскрутить сайт самостоятельно.